The RootSignal method
Separate what the vehicle does from fault-code descriptions, previous diagnoses, and parts already replaced.
Reduce the problem to power, ground, command, response, communication, and mechanical effect. Find the boundary where expected behavior stops.
Use wiring information, scan data, voltage-drop tests, current measurements, oscilloscopes, and network captures where each tool can answer a specific question.
Repeat the condition, compare known-good behavior, and look for evidence that contradicts the leading theory before condemning a component.

A fault code identifies where a control system noticed trouble. It does not automatically identify the failed part. RootSignal combines reported symptoms with measurements from the circuit and the vehicle's operating state.
